質問編集履歴
2
使用目的のはっきりしない変数の目的を追記させて頂きました。
test
CHANGED
File without changes
|
test
CHANGED
@@ -131,3 +131,19 @@
|
|
131
131
|
End Function
|
132
132
|
|
133
133
|
```
|
134
|
+
|
135
|
+
【追記】
|
136
|
+
|
137
|
+
G列の最終行番号を取得する理由
|
138
|
+
|
139
|
+
まだ、コード化していないのですが、変数TargetとG列の最終行をマッチングさせたい。
|
140
|
+
|
141
|
+
次のようなコードを考えております。
|
142
|
+
|
143
|
+
If Datasheet.Cells(Lr, 7).Value <> Target Then
|
144
|
+
|
145
|
+
MsgBox "エラーメッセージ"
|
146
|
+
|
147
|
+
exit function
|
148
|
+
|
149
|
+
End if
|
1
正しく代入できません。と記載したのですが、わかりにくいので「←G列の最終行番号を取得したいのですが正しく代入できません。(1が代入されてしまいます)」と変更致しました。
test
CHANGED
File without changes
|
test
CHANGED
@@ -80,9 +80,9 @@
|
|
80
80
|
|
81
81
|
.AutoFilterMode = False
|
82
82
|
|
83
|
-
Lr = .Cells(Rows.count, 7).End(xlUp).Row '←
|
83
|
+
Lr = .Cells(Rows.count, 7).End(xlUp).Row '←G列の最終行番号を取得したいのですが正しく代入できません。(1が代入されてしまいます)
|
84
84
|
|
85
|
-
'Lr = .Range("G1").End(xlDown).Row '←こちらは正しく代入できます。
|
85
|
+
'Lr = .Range("G1").End(xlDown).Row '←こちらは正しくG列の最終行番号が代入できます。
|
86
86
|
|
87
87
|
End With
|
88
88
|
|